AppUFO is a macOS desktop tool designed for developers to localize applications using AI. It imports localization files such as .xcstrings, translates them into over 36 languages while preserving formatting placeholders, plurals, and glossary terms, then exports them back to the project. Features include context-aware translations, batch processing, duplicate/missing string detection, previews, character limit enforcement, and version history.
